Take a different route to a degree with an apprenticeship
Degree apprenticeships are a popular alternative route to full-time university education.
If you are a school leaver looking for an alternative route to university, or an existing employee seeking a higher-level qualification to enhance your career progression, a higher or degree apprenticeship from NTU here in Nottingham is the ideal choice.
We offer apprenticeships starting from Level 3 up to Level 7. Our award-winning courses are the perfect for the next step in your career!
